A Hybrid Architecture: Off-Chain Power, On-Chain Trust

At the core of APRO Oracle is a hybrid system that merges off-chain computation with on-chain verification. Heavy data aggregation and processing happen off-chain, reducing network congestion and gas costs. The final verified results are then delivered on-chain, ensuring transparency and integrity.

This design allows APRO to scale efficiently while maintaining the security standards expected by serious DeFi and Web3 applications. It also enables complex computation logic that would otherwise be impractical if executed fully on-chain.

Data Push and Data Pull: Designed for Real-World Use Cases

APRO Data Service supports two complementary data models:

Data Push is designed for continuous updates. Independent node operators monitor market conditions and automatically push updates to the blockchain when predefined thresholds or time intervals are met. This model is ideal for applications that need consistent, real-time price feeds without excessive on-chain interactions.

Data Pull, on the other hand, is optimized for on-demand access. Applications can request data only when needed, enabling high-frequency updates with low latency and reduced costs. This approach is particularly useful for decentralized exchanges, derivatives protocols, and dynamic trading systems.

Together, these models allow APRO to serve a wide range of DApp business scenarios without forcing developers into a one-size-fits-all solution.

Institutional-Grade Data Accuracy

APRO aggregates price data from institutional-grade providers and major exchanges using a TVWAP (Time-Volume Weighted Average Price) mechanism. This method improves price accuracy while reducing the impact of short-term volatility and market manipulation.

By sourcing data from multiple high-quality providers and applying rigorous aggregation logic, APRO ensures that its price feeds reflect fair market conditions rather than isolated anomalies.

Security Through Decentralization and Verification

Security is a foundational principle of the APRO network. The oracle operates through a decentralized set of submitter nodes supported by secure multi-party computation and trusted execution environments.

APRO’s Off-Chain Message Protocol (OCMP) retrieves data from multiple independent sources, minimizing single points of failure. A dedicated Verdict Layer resolves inconsistencies and disputes, ensuring data integrity before final submission. Importantly, node privacy is preserved during off-chain aggregation, protecting operators while maintaining transparency.

This layered security model makes APRO suitable for applications where data reliability directly impacts user funds.

Multi-Chain Reach and Network Stability

APRO currently supports over 160 price feeds across 15 major blockchain networks. A multi-network communication design improves reliability and reduces the risk of downtime caused by single network failures.
